QUEER MINORITIES SHORTS

This short film program centers voices that are too often pushed to the margins — stories of
queer lives shaped by intersectional realities, complex identities, and sometimes loud resistance. With moving and thoughtful
films from around the globe, this program offers space for stories that often remain unheard, yet are vital to the full picture
of queer existence. A powerful and uplifting selection that celebrates visibility, empathy, and the richness of queer experiences
in all their forms.

Yasak Aşk -Forbidden Love, Yavuz Kurtulmus, Austria 2025, no dialogue with EN subs, 12 min
Maghreb's hope, Bassem Ben Brahim, Tunisia 2023, Arabic OV with EN subs, 24 min
Neon roses, Iven Tu, United States 2023, English, 11 min
Du Bist So Wunderbar (Paradise Europe), Leandro Goddinho & Paulo Menezes, Germany 2023, English, German, Portuguese OV with EN subs, 17 min
Shoot Your Shot, Mishaal Memon, UK & India, 2022, English OV, 12 min
